vote to advance the nomination of another well qualified individual, texas supreme court justice don willett to serve on the sixth circuit court of appeals. justice willett respects the rule of law and foundational legal principles and he will be a strong addition to the fifth circuit. his story is an inspirational one, adopted at a young age and raised by a widowed mother in a town of 32 people. he was the first person in his family to grad yate from the -- graduate from high school. as our colleague senator cornyn said at the judiciary committee committee hearing, his life will reflect the best of texas and the best of america. from these humble beginnings, justice willett has led a remarkable career. after graduating from duke law school he clerked for judge williams. he has now been nominated to the package to join. he spints a short time in private practice before entering public service and then -- and then governor george w. bush's administration as a legal policy advisor. when president bush entered the white house, justice willett joined him as a special assistant to the president.

texas supreme court justice don willett and former texas solicitor general jim ho. these will be the 11th and 12th court of appeals nominees that we will have confirmed this year, a modern-day record. indeed, i looked up just the other day the number of assigned slots on the federal courts of appeals. it's 179, which means the 12 that have been nominated and confirmed this year represent roughly 7% of the appellate bench. that is a powerful accomplishment for the first year of the presidency, a powerful accomplishment for this republican majority in the senate, and a powerful legacy that will extend decades into the future protecting our constitutional rights, protecting the bill of rights, protecting the first amendment, our free speech, our religious liberty. protecting the second amendment, protecting all the fundamental liberties we enjoy as americans. with respect to don willett and jim ho, i have known the both of them for decades. both are close friends. both are brilliant lawyers. both have spent decades earning a reputation as principled constitutionalists
